Which Boots Does Nike Offer?

To kick off your search, here's a rundown of Nike's line-up of kids' football boots. They accommodate different playing styles, whether your child focuses most on speed, precision, or ball touch and comfort.

Nike Jr Mercurial

Built for speed, Nike Jr Mercurial boots are designed for young players who rely on explosive acceleration and quick direction changes. They're ideal for wingers and strikers.

Nike Jr Mercurial Superfly: Nike's fastest boot features a NikeLite plate with a traction pattern that allows for free movement and a soft NikeSkin upper for optimal comfort.

Nike Jr Mercurial Vapor: designed for quick cuts, this lightweight boot utilises exclusive Nike technology that supports quick turns and smooth changes of direction.

Nike Jr Phantom

How to Choose Football Boots for Kids

The best Nike football boots for kids
The best Nike football boots for kids

Ready to give football-shoe shopping a shot? Before your child tries on boots, consider these factors.

Playing style: think about your child's football position (Tiempo for defenders, Phantom for midfielders, and Mercurial or Phantom for strikers), and whether they prioritise speed (Mercurial), precision (Phantom), or ball touch and comfort (Tiempo).

Playing surface: determine which surface they play on most frequently. Here's a rundown of the different types of surfaces with the features that cater to them.

  • Firm ground (FG): designed for outdoor natural grass fields, featuring conical studs for stability and grip
  • Turf (TF): made for artificial grass or turf fields, with shorter rubber studs that provide traction to help maintain balance (without damaging the surface)
  • Indoor courts (IC): flat, rubber soles designed for grip on indoor surfaces
  • Multi-ground (MG): versatile boots with stud patterns suitable for mixed surfaces, ideal for players who play on various pitches

Each boot in the Nike Jr line-up comes in different versions for these different surfaces.

Experience: beginners benefit from softer uppers and cushioning, while more experienced players often prefer responsive plates in the soles to help boost speed and ball control.

Kids' Football Boots Sizing Guide

Fit should come first when it comes to enhancing enjoyment and play and reducing the risk of injury. Before heading to the store, have your child wear the socks they use for football. Then, seek out football boots that fit snugly yet do not pinch. Make sure there's about a thumb's width of space between the big toe and the boot's tip and that the heel doesn't slip. Although you might be tempted to size up to accommodate growth, choose shoes that fit properly now.

When should kids get new football boots?

Replace kids' football boots every six to eight months. But consider doing so sooner if the shoes become too tight or show signs of wear (worn studs, splitting seams or holes in the uppers). To help extend their life, clean them regularly.
